We are a group of people who like to try out different 'crafts' and sometimes identify one that we really like and continue within our own time.
It's great to find a new hobby. This is what it is all about, trying different things and finding a new interest that we may not have thought of before.
We make a lot of cards for different occasions, and jewellery using many different methods. We have made numerous bags of different shapes and sizes.
We try various 'paper crafts' which included the art of folding books. This is a craft that was learnt from another U3A member which proved enjoyable. The technique uses an old book and the pages are very carefully folded to a pattern to make an unusual decorative item.
The sewing machine comes in useful sometimes when a needle and thread would just take too long.
Silk painting and felt making are also amongst our many and varied activities.
Members keep coming up with lots of unusual and new ideas to keep us interested and promoting help within the group which is very much appreciated. We are such a clever 'crafty' lot at Bicester U3A.
